When you think of South Indian dishes the first thing that cross your mind is IDLI. And when you talk about Idli. It is Murgan Idli Shop in Triplicane. The light fluffy idlis at Murgan are a treat. The soft steamed rice cakes are served on a banana leaf with a variety of chutneys- mint, tomatoes, coconut & mali. The steaming Sambhar added on top of the idlis makes it more mouth watering. The dish can be enjoyed as a snack or a meal.
Sweet Pongal too is the specialty of Murgan but it was too sweet. You can even munch on dosa, curd rice & utthapams etc. If nothing you can sip a cup of coffee. It’s worth drinking.
The décor is simple with South Indian ambience, as you enjoy the rice cakes you can have a vivid view of the road outside. Open all days from 5:30pm to 11:30 pm, a perfect place for Idli date, Aiyya.-yo!
